Description

The uncoated 1-lb. loaf pan from Chicago Metallic's Commercial line upholds a baking tradition, and adds the modern benefit of being dishwasher-safe. Durable aluminized steel is crafted to experts' standards for long-lasting performance.

Features

  • Traditional, uncoated heavy-gauge aluminized steel
  • Shiny surface keeps light pound cakes from overbrowning
  • Ideal for breads, cakes, meatloaf, or terrines
  • Dishwasher-safe
  • 25-year limited warranty

Customer Reviews

  1. Metal residue on pans

    I am a frequent home baker. After years of using non-stick pans, I was super excited to get some good old metal pans. I bought four. The pans are nice sized, heaby duty, conduct well, etc. I am pleased with their baking performance. HOWEVER, I have had the pans for over 6 months now and the pans still have a metallic residue. After a good washing, when I pick up the dry pans, my fingers are gray. I have to wipe down the pans before using every time. I called the company and they said the residue should go away after a good washing. I have scrubbed by hand, by wash rag, scrubber, dishwasher, on and on to no avail. While the pans may work well, I don't like the idea of some sort of pan residue baking onto my food.

  3. Nice pan but they rust!

    Let me start by saying I'm not your average loaf pan user. I make bread every other day. I have 2 of these pans and while they are FAR superior to their non-stick counterparts they do have a problem with rust spots. I hand wash and dry them BUT the side folds trap water and condensation in the humid Florida climate as well. I use them now only with a parchment inlay and will be likely replacing them with cast iron. I have the mini-loaf versions as well and they rust very fast- upon initial use. These took a good 6 months of heavy usage before the rust started creeping in. I must say, however, that even with the aluminum base they do not salt which is a huge asset seeing as some of my cast iron/aluminum pots salt I really appreciate that they don't!
